r/WallStreetBets has delivered its sharpest backlash yet against an SEC proposal that would let public companies report only twice a year. Retail traders argue the move would reduce transparency, slow reactions to losses, and tilt power toward insiders who see results first. The proposal is now facing louder pushback before any final rulemaking.
